United States Electric Vehicle Market Size and Forecast 2025–2033

How America’s EV Boom Is Reshaping the Future of Transportation

By jaiklin FanandishPublished about a month ago 5 min read

The United States Electric Vehicle (EV) market is entering an era of unprecedented expansion, driven by shifting consumer preferences, advancing technology, and federal and state-level commitments to carbon reduction. According to Renub Research, the U.S. Electric Vehicle market is expected to reach US$ 537.53 billion by 2033, rising dramatically from US$ 200.76 billion in 2024. This reflects a strong CAGR of 11.56% from 2025 to 2033, a pace that positions the U.S. as a central force in the global transition to electric mobility.

Multiple factors fuel this surge—rising environmental awareness, the urgency to cut emissions, rapid strides in battery technology, government incentives, and heavy investment in renewable energy. As the nation accelerates toward an electrified future, both opportunities and challenges shape how the industry evolves.

United States Electric Vehicle Industry Overview

The U.S. EV landscape is undergoing transformation as automakers diversify their offerings across segments and price points. Brands such as Ford, Chevrolet, Nissan, Hyundai, and Tesla are introducing electric vehicles that appeal to a broad spectrum of consumers—from budget-conscious buyers to luxury enthusiasts. The market’s evolution increasingly reflects consumers’ desire for improved range, performance, and advanced digital features.

A notable example is Hyundai’s announcement of the revamped 2025 IONIQ 5 lineup in September 2024, including the rugged IONIQ 5 XRT edition tailored for off-road users. With greater driving range, improved efficiency, and enhanced safety features, such models illustrate how innovation drives adoption.

Despite these advancements, the U.S. still grapples with a significant obstacle: uneven distribution of charging infrastructure. Urban regions have experienced rapid charger installation, while rural and suburban areas remain underserved. This disparity restricts EV usability for millions of Americans.

According to the International Council on Clean Transportation (ICCT), the 10 most populous U.S. metropolitan areas average 935 public chargers per million residents and have a 10% electric share of registered vehicles. Yet these same metro areas contain only 20% of all chargers available across the population areas where half of Americans live. This gap highlights the urgent need for more workplace and public charging stations to achieve equitable EV adoption nationwide.

Growth Drivers for the United States Electric Vehicle Market

1. Subsidies, Government Incentives, and R&D Investments

Federal and state incentives continue to make EVs more financially accessible. Many states encourage adoption through:

Free parking for EVs

Reduced or zero registration fees

Discounted toll rates

State rebates in addition to federal tax credits

Investment in public charging infrastructure

California remains the nation’s trailblazer, offering substantial rebates for plug-in hybrids (PHEVs) and fully electric vehicles. Low-income families qualify for an additional US$ 2,000 incentive. Meanwhile, states like Washington and New Jersey exempt EV purchases from sales and usage taxes.

Louisiana and Maryland offer up to US$ 2,500 and US$ 3,000 per EV, respectively. Such measures have directly accelerated adoption and will continue to strengthen market growth through 2033.

2. Tight Vehicle Emission Regulations

The U.S. government is ramping up efforts to reduce automotive emissions, implementing strict standards that compel automakers to transition toward electrification. Many states have adopted Zero Emission Vehicle (ZEV) mandates, which already accounted for nearly two-thirds of EV sales in 2020.

Automakers are responding aggressively. General Motors pledged to end production of gasoline-powered passenger vehicles by 2035, marking one of the most significant commitments from a legacy automaker in modern history. As regulatory frameworks tighten, EV sales are expected to accelerate, creating sustained momentum throughout the forecast period.

3. Technological Advancements in Batteries and Improved Range

Battery innovation sits at the heart of the EV revolution. Historically, range anxiety and charging limitations were major deterrents for potential buyers. Today, new lithium-ion chemistries, improved energy density, and advanced battery management systems have drastically enhanced vehicle range.

Longer ranges—at increasingly affordable price points—are boosting consumer confidence. As companies advance toward solid-state batteries, faster charging speeds, and cost-effective battery recycling systems, EVs will become even more appealing to mass-market consumers.

Battery improvements not only increase convenience but also lower lifetime ownership costs, making EVs one of the most economical transportation options.

Challenges in the United States Electric Vehicle Market

1. Competition from Traditional Automakers

While new EV startups have gained attention, legacy automotive giants pose a formidable challenge. With decades of manufacturing experience, supply chain dominance, and strong retail networks, companies like Ford, GM, Toyota, and BMW are rapidly expanding their electric portfolios.

This competition benefits the market by increasing availability and innovation but also makes it difficult for newer entrants to differentiate themselves. Startups are under pressure to secure funding, scale production, and build consumer trust—tasks complicated by the intensifying race for market share.

2. Limited Availability of Models Across Segments

Although EV model variety is improving, key gaps remain. The truck segment especially lacks diverse electric options compared to traditional gasoline-powered counterparts. Consumers in regions where trucks serve as daily workhorses face fewer choices.

Additionally, while mid-priced EVs are growing in number, affordable small EVs remain scarce. Price-sensitive buyers may not yet find models that align with their budget or lifestyle. This shortage of segment diversity continues to be a barrier to wider adoption.

Segment Insights: What’s Driving Market Dynamics?

Battery Electric Vehicles (BEVs) Take the Lead

BEVs dominate the U.S. EV market thanks to falling battery prices, improving range, and rising environmental consciousness. Strong federal incentives, expanding charging coverage, and aggressive automaker investment all reinforce BEVs’ growing market share.

Consumers are drawn to:

Zero tailpipe emissions

Low maintenance costs

Quiet and smooth driving performance

Lower long-term fuel expenses

As the U.S. moves toward sustainable transportation, BEVs will remain at the forefront of EV adoption.

The 151–300 Miles Range Segment Leads the Market

EVs offering 151–300 miles of range represent the sweet spot for American consumers. This category provides enough mileage for daily commuting, weekend travel, and low-range anxiety—without significantly inflating vehicle costs.

Automakers increasingly focus on this range segment due to its balance of affordability, practicality, and technological efficiency. As charge times shorten and public chargers expand, vehicles in the 151–300-mile range will continue to dominate.

Passenger Cars Hold the Largest Market Share

Passenger cars—compact models, sedans, and small SUVs—remain the backbone of U.S. EV adoption. Automakers prioritize electrifying these models because they cater to the broadest customer base.

Key factors boosting passenger EV penetration include:

Growing city charging access

Government incentives

Attractive pricing for mid-range EVs

Rapidly improving battery efficiency

Electric passenger cars are expected to remain the strongest-selling category through 2033.

Mid-Priced EVs Dominate the Market

Mid-priced EVs strike the perfect balance between cost, features, and range. They attract both first-time EV buyers and budget-conscious families.

Consumers value:

Strong safety ratings

Sufficient range for daily use

Lower operating cost versus gasoline cars

Advanced digital and autonomous features

Government rebates further enhance affordability, making mid-priced EVs the driving force behind mainstream market adoption.
